    It's not a plug, it's a cigar lighter. My 72 Commando had the same style, small chrome button you push to heat the lighter and then you pull it out with the two small finger grips on the sides. My 74 CJ5 has a different style lighter, the familiar later style that almost every vehicle has, with the rubber knob that sticks out (and is much easier to pull out). So I can't say whether this is stock for a 72 CJ5 or whether it was added from a different Jeep vehicle (I suspect the Commando and Full-Size Jeeps used the same type of lighter).
